Output e32aba354cb8cee7ff4d5cefb4efd338672c7eeda2f05fbc9cbe4e7e56fd7646:0

value
1039121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 614c8054c0e52ecf2d2c9f620568cc29d4a89814 OP_EQUAL
address
3AZV7Z74naQNwEqbgLcCZLKJ5141kyzwjg
transaction
e32aba354cb8cee7ff4d5cefb4efd338672c7eeda2f05fbc9cbe4e7e56fd7646
confirmations
385444
spent
true